Banda Aceh, Aceh, July 3 (Antara) - Nine people were found dead in Aceh provincial district of Aceh Tengah (Central Aceh) after 6.2 magnitude quake hit the area on Tuesday afternoon (July 2), a district official said.
The quake also caused power blackout following the major quake, Head of Sub District Ketol, M. Saleh, said on Tuesday night.
"Aftershocks also caused people in panic," he said, adding that a two-floor elementary school building was also fully destroyed by the quake.
The powerful quake left heavy damages in Kampung Bah, Belang Mancung, Simpang Rajawali, Ponok Balik, and Jalok.
Eight of the nine victims were found dead under the building rubles in Ponok Balik, Ketol, Central Aceh. "The evacuation was hampered by power outage after the aftershohcks," he said.
The Indonesian Military (TNI) personnel led by Chief of district military command 0106/Central Aceh Commander (Inf) Lalu Habib still help evacuating the wounded from the rubles. (*/DWA)
